How to Go About Repairing Double Glazing Windows

Double-glazed windows are often sold with warranties that cover them for up to 20 years. If you notice problems you're looking to fix, contact the company who sold you the windows to learn what their policy for jerealas.Top repairs.

Repairing your double-glazed windows can be a simple process in certain instances. Here are a few of the most common problems that can be solved.

Broken Glass

Double pane windows require an airtight seal to hold the glass's outer and inner parts together. If one of the glass panes cracks it could be extremely difficult to remove the broken piece without damaging the frame of the window. This type of damage may also lead to a loss in energy efficiency. Therefore, it is crucial to fix it quickly and correctly.

It is a good thing that repairing broken glass in double-glazing windows is an easy job that can be accomplished at home with a few tools and materials. To begin take off any loose pieces of broken glass from the frame. Wear protective gloves since broken glass could contain dangerous fragments. After getting rid of the broken glass use a dampened rag with alcohol or rubbing alcohol to clean the the frame. This will remove any adhesive residue.

Then, take any remaining glazing points from the frame with a putty knife. After all glazing points are removed clean the backside and Jerealas.Top an l-shaped space inside the window frame. Finally, prepare to install a new pane of glass by cleaning the old glass and the new frame using a wire brush. After the frame has been cleaned, jerealas apply a small amount of glazier's glue to the glass's edge to secure it against the frame.

Certain kinds of windows utilize aluminum, vinyl or wood stops to hold the glass in place instead of glazier's points. If your double-glazed windows are of this kind then you'll need use a utility knife to slice through the tape on both sides to take the stop from the frame, without destroying it. Once the stop has been removed and the tape strip is removed, you can apply a strong-hold strip to the surface of the new window to prevent further damage.

Seals that leak

If your double glazed windows leak and the seals around the frame have likely failed. This is a serious problem because it indicates that all the thermally insulating gas is leaking out and the window is not performing as efficiently. This can lead you to spend more on heating because windows aren't as efficient as they once were.

Luckily, there are some warning signs to be aware of to keep a drafty window from developing. If you notice that your windows are draughty even when closed it could be because the seal has broken and needs to be replaced. There may also be condensation on the glass, which is another sign that the seals are not working properly.

The easiest way to eliminate a draught is to simply replace the seals around the frames. This is a difficult job that requires specialized tools in order to avoid damaging the window glass. It is recommended to contact an experienced glass firm to perform this task, since they will be able to use deglazing equipment to remove the old seals and harm the glass.

In some cases it is possible to fix your leaky double-glazed windows using a silicone putty to fill the gaps. This isn't the best solution since it doesn't provide a high resistance to heat and is susceptible to leaks in the future. However, it is worth a try if you have no other options.

The seals on double-glazed windows made of rubber can break over time. This can be caused by environmental conditions, age or the manner in which your windows are installed. It is important to replace the seals as soon as you can so that your double-glazed windows are as effective as when they first came out.

A window that is drafty is often the most obvious indication that your double glazing is not performing to its best. There will be drafts around the frame's edges, where the frame meets the brickwork or the wall. The seal has broken and air can get in. In certain cases this may result in damp patches on the walls, though this is less common.

Condensation

Double-glazing windows are a great choice for homeowners looking to reduce their energy costs and improve the insulation of their home. They are durable and long-lasting but they do require some maintenance.

One common problem that windows with double glazing experience is condensation. The appearance of condensation is often the first sign that the seal of the window has failed. If the appearance of condensation is not addressed quickly, it can lead to the growth of mould and Jerealas.top (https://www.jerealas.top/1sx-zq42-r29v-2ksb7-er5ty-4456) eventually wood rot.

Condensation is most commonly seen in the morning when temperatures rise and humidity levels increase, causing water vapour to form. This is the case for your windows. It's not usually a issue, but you should wipe off any visible condensation as fast as possible to prevent it from setting in.

But condensation isn't always the sign of a failing seal, and there are many other reasons why your double-glazed windows may be leaking. Over time, the rubber seals in windows that are double-glazed may wear out. The rubber seals can wear down over time, which causes them to break. This can cause the air gap to become depressurized. air gap between the glass panes. If you notice signs of condensation or misting it is crucial to get your double-glazed windows fixed immediately.

A tradesperson can fix a double-glazed window that has condensation by removing the affected pane, then putting it back into its place. They will then push hot air through the gap to eliminate any moisture. Then, they'll apply an additional seal to keep the gap airtight.

It is important to remember that fixing your double-glazed windows can be much less expensive than purchasing and installing new ones. Frame Damage

It's possible that one the seals on your frame is damaged if you hear crackling noises or other unusual sounds emanating from the double-glazed windows. These seals keep cold and water out of the space between the glass panes. It is essential to replace them as soon as you can to stop moisture from getting into your home.

Fractures may break because of general wear and tear or from impact damage caused by pets or children. Most of the time, this can be fixed with a simple fix, such as using silicone to fill in the gap or sanding down the area. However, more severe damage may require the introduction of new window frames, jerealas.top which is not something you want to take on your own unless you're a competent tradesman.

A common double-glazing problem is that it may be difficult to open or close. This could result from a buildup of dust and dirt in the track or a structural problem such as warping. Based on the severity, this could be a simple issue to fix with a bit of elbow grease and a gentle push.

Moisture that enters through damaged double-glazed windows can cause dampness inside your home, and mold and condensation. The warm air inside your home is more likely to hold moisture than the cooler air outside, which is why it will be able to settle on surfaces like windows with single or double glazing that are not properly sealed.

The good part is that these issues can be fixed, and it's often less expensive than replacing your windows altogether. Double glazing problems are typically covered by a warranty, typically for 10 or 20 year however some companies offer lifetime warranties. Be sure to verify your warranty before you begin work.
